FAST, Inc. based in Stratford, Connecticut, is the leading manufacturer of appliance controls and on-line kitchen networking products specially developed for use in the foodservice industry. FAST products, based on digitalDNA™ technology from Motorola, can be found in major restaurants worldwide, including KFC, Burger King, Popeyes, Arby's, Church's Chicken, Taco Bell, Jack in the Box, and others.

Founded in 1969 and headquartered in Stratford, Connecticut, with offices in London, Shanghai and Singapore, FAST is an internationally recognized leader in the design and manufacture of process controls within the worldwide foodservice marketplace.

Senior Hardware Design Engineer

FAST is seeking a Senior Hardware Design Engineer for their Embedded Hardware Design Group. Candidate is expected to be a key contributor in the architecture, design, and implementation of microcontroller based systems.

Candidate must possess the analytical skills related to designing products for the restaurant industry. Technical knowledge in motor controls, RF technology, communication networks, and graphical interfaces are desired. The candidate is expected to use solid engineering practices in specifying and documenting all phases of the work.

Position Responsibilities:

  • Plans, conducts and directs engineering research and development projects.
  • In depth experience with embedded microprocessor based design techniques and peripherals.
  • Practical knowledge of C programming for embedded systems.
  • Working knowledge of RF for Zigee, Bluetooth and WiFi applications.
  • Practical knowledge of processor systems supporting Linux, VxWorks, etc.
  • Hands-on working knowledge of instrumentation and control engineering.
  • In depth knowledge of various standard network communication topologies, including Ethernet, I2C, RS232, RS485/422, TCP/IP and CAN/LIN Bus.
  • Working knowledge of proportional feedback control systems.
  • Design of AC and DC motor controllers using PID methodologies.
  • Familiarity with different types of display technologies such as, VFD, LCD, and graphic LCD.
  • Excellent verbal and writing skills.
  • Provide mentoring for other hardware engineers.

Position Requirements:

  • BS in Electrical Engineering, MS preferred.
  • Minimum of 10 years of Electrical Engineering experience
